GnuseJay Posted December 25, 2017 Share Posted December 25, 2017 I am unable to connect to my Smoke Bridge. It is listed in the devices, but it gives me a message that it cannot determine the Insteon Engine xx.xx.xx INSTEON Smoke Sensor v.00 - Cannot determne Insteon Engine Any suggestions? Link to comment
Michel Kohanim Posted December 25, 2017 Share Posted December 25, 2017 Hi GnuseJay, This is usually related to signal/noise issue. You might want to move the PLM to a different outlet and one which is not shared with other transformers and power supplies. With kind regards, Michel Link to comment
stusviews Posted December 27, 2017 Share Posted December 27, 2017 If you find that powering the PLM from another outlet is successful, then you need to consider that something on the original circuit is causing line noise and should be filtered to minimize the probability of future problems. At that point, you can safely plug the PLM into the original place. Link to comment
GnuseJay Posted December 30, 2017 Author Share Posted December 30, 2017 I moved the PLM to a separate outlet. I get the same results. Link to comment
paulbates Posted December 30, 2017 Share Posted December 30, 2017 Did you try using the "Start linking" option, and then put the smokebridge in linking mode? Its been a while since I had this device, but my recollection was I had to do it that way Paul Link to comment
